Lewiston girls' lacrosse receives grant

LEWISTON — Athletes at Lewiston High School will receive from a $1,000 California Casualty Thomas R. Brown Athletics Grant. The money will allow the school to purchase uniforms and equipment for the girls lacrosse team. Coach Brant Remington said the uniforms will help boost self-esteem and pride for the student-athletes. Local roundup: Lewiston girls' lacrosse, Oxford Hills baseball win KVAC championships

WATERVILLE — Christine Chasse and Grace Dumond netted five goals each as Lewiston cruised to a 15-4 victory over Winslow in the KVAC girls’ lacrosse championship game Saturday.
